summ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--tools/build/feature/Makefile2
-rw-r--r--tools/scripts/Makefile.include2
-rw-r--r--tools/tracing/rtla/Makefile2
3 files changed, 3 insertions, 3 deletions
diff --git a/tools/build/feature/Makefile b/tools/build/feature/Makefile
index 4f9c1d950f5d..b8b5fb183dd4 100644
--- a/tools/build/feature/Makefile
+++ b/tools/build/feature/Makefile
@@ -419,7 +419,7 @@ $(OUTPUT)test-libpfm4.bin:
$(BUILD) -lpfm
$(OUTPUT)test-bpftool-skeletons.bin:
- $(BPFTOOL) version | grep '^features:.*skeletons' \
+ $(SYSTEM_BPFTOOL) version | grep '^features:.*skeletons' \
> $(@:.bin=.make.output) 2>&1
###############################
diff --git a/tools/scripts/Makefile.include b/tools/scripts/Makefile.include
index 71bbe52721b3..34a33c1ad96c 100644
--- a/tools/scripts/Makefile.include
+++ b/tools/scripts/Makefile.include
@@ -92,7 +92,7 @@ LLVM_OBJCOPY ?= llvm-objcopy
LLVM_STRIP ?= llvm-strip
# Some tools require bpftool
-BPFTOOL ?= bpftool
+SYSTEM_BPFTOOL ?= bpftool
ifeq ($(CC_NO_CLANG), 1)
EXTRA_WARNINGS += -Wstrict-aliasing=3
diff --git a/tools/tracing/rtla/Makefile b/tools/tracing/rtla/Makefile
index 557af322be61..3dc050317b9d 100644
--- a/tools/tracing/rtla/Makefile
+++ b/tools/tracing/rtla/Makefile
@@ -78,7 +78,7 @@ src/timerlat.bpf.o: src/timerlat.bpf.c
$(QUIET_CLANG)$(CLANG) -g -O2 -target bpf -c $(filter %.c,$^) -o $@
src/timerlat.skel.h: src/timerlat.bpf.o
- $(QUIET_GENSKEL)$(BPFTOOL) gen skeleton $< > $@
+ $(QUIET_GENSKEL)$(SYSTEM_BPFTOOL) gen skeleton $< > $@
else
src/timerlat.skel.h:
$(Q)echo '/* BPF skeleton is disabled */' > src/timerlat.skel.h